Meet Our 2026 Special Guests: Community, Creators, and Competition

The Hunter Burton Memorial Open is a celebration of the community that sustains us. This year, we are proud to host a lineup of guests who are talented creators and champions for the gaming community.

From world-class cosplay to high-stakes cEDH, here is who you can expect to see at the 2026 HBMO.


The Guest Lineup

Parker Bliss

Parker Bliss is a content creator, tabletop personality and cosplayer, currently based in Denver, Colorado. She has been creating content online since 2023. What began as a love of cosplay and conventions has blossomed into a lifelong passion that also includes TTRPGs, medieval reenactment, TCGs, ren faires, and all things high fantasy.

Anna Margaret

Anna Margaret is a nerdy lifestyle content creator, character actress, and gaming personality. With a Masters degree in teaching and decades of performance experience, Anna Margaret loves bringing characters and fandoms to life through costumes, photography, music, and video content. Best known for her bubbly personality, elaborate cosplays, and enthusiasm for introducing people to her favorite hobbies, she loves to host events, GM table top roleplaying games, and play trading card games!

PowrDragn

PowrDragn is a full time Magic content creator, but has ties to the gaming industry that go back over 25 years. He has been a part of the HBMO doing interviews and covering the event for several years now. He has just completed 6 years of daily content on YouTube, but you can also find him on most socials.

Zabracus

Zabracus (Za-Bruh-Cuss) is a celebrated figure in the geek and gaming community from Northern California. As a Twitch Partner and MTG Ambassador (2023 to present), Zab shares her chaotic misplays and adventures in Magic: The Gathering, and other TCGs and TTRPGs across Twitch, YouTube, and Instagram.

Known for her stunning cosplays, she has brought characters like Shadowheart (Baldur’s Gate 3), Zatanna (DC Comics), and Thalia (MTG) to life, earning her over 60 guest appearances at conventions across the U.S. and Canada. Beyond cosplay and streaming, she’s an accomplished voice and commercial actress. Zabracus co-founded Super Sonic Speed Dating and Nerdvana Talent, fostering geek communities and creative talent.


Where to Find Our Guests

Our guests will be active throughout the weekend participating in events and meeting with the community. Here are a few ways you can interact with them during the show:

  • Friday: Riftbound Learn to Play If you want to learn the ropes of Riftbound, stop by our dedicated learn to play area on Friday afternoon. Our guests will be on hand for a few hours to help teach the game and run some casual matches.
  • Saturday: cEDH Tournament Keep an eye out for our guests in the pods of the cEDH tournament on Saturday. They will be competing throughout the day and potentially into Sunday if they make the day 2 cut.
  • Cosplay Meetup and Prizes Whether you are a seasoned crafter or just wearing your favorite nerdy shirt, join us on Saturday for a community cosplay meetup. Come show off your work, grab photos with our featured cosplayers, and walk away with a special prize.
